Strum Machine โ€“ Backing Tracks features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    Strum Machine features a user-friendly interface that allows musicians to easily create and customize their backing tracks with minimal effort.
  • Flexible Tempo and Key Changes
    The software provides easy options to adjust tempo and key, enabling musicians to practice at their own pace and in their preferred key.
  • Large Library of Songs
    Strum Machine offers an extensive library of songs, particularly in genres like bluegrass and folk, allowing users to find and use familiar tunes quickly.
  • Offline Access
    Once songs are loaded, Strum Machine allows users to access and play tracks offline, making it convenient for practice without needing constant internet access.
  • Customizable Arrangements
    Musicians can modify song arrangements, chords, and repetitions, tailoring the practice sessions according to their needs.

Possible disadvantages of Strum Machine โ€“ Backing Tracks

  • Subscription Cost
    Strum Machine requires a monthly or annual subscription, which can be a deterrent for musicians on a tight budget.
  • Limited Genre Selection
    Though rich in folk and bluegrass tunes, the software may not cater well to musicians looking for tracks outside of these and similar genres.
  • Basic Audio Quality
    The backing tracks might not offer the high-quality audio that professional recordings provide, potentially affecting the practice experience.
  • Dependent on Preloaded Progressions
    While users can create their own songs, some might find the reliance on preloaded chord progressions limiting if seeking specific or complex arrangements.
  • Lack of Advanced Features
    Compared to other sophisticated music software, Strum Machine may lack advanced features such as recording capabilities or integration with other digital audio workstations (DAWs).
